F.M. Yeager of 433½ Penn Street, Reading, Pennsylvania produced this albumen carte de visite as a promotional image for his gallery, assembling studio props, decorative objects, and a display of his own photographic work into a single composed advertisement for his services. The reverse reinforces the intent, printed with the bold heading "Prices Reduced" above his studio imprint. The format and mount style are consistent with the 1870s.

A large classical campana-form urn planted with foliage dominates the upper center, set on a pedestal above a framed grid of twelve oval portrait medallions arranged in three rows, almost certainly a selection of Yeager's own portrait work displayed as samples. At left, a small wooden tripod supports a funnel or flask beside a dark glass bottle. A porcelain or bisque figural charioteer group occupies the center foreground, flanked at right by a small white bust on a damask-covered table. Two adjustable articulated metal stands extend into the composition from both sides, and a draped fabric panel hangs at left.

The reverse is printed with "Prices Reduced" above the studio imprint for F.M. Yeager, with a handwritten negative number 9469 and the notation "Duplicates Retained." A penciled notation reading "Lot" followed by partially legible numbers appears at the upper edge.
